A key feature of this specific download is the inclusion of the Terjemahan (translation). Reciting prayers in Arabic is a matter of ritual, but understanding them in one's native tongue—such as Malay or Indonesian—is a matter of the heart. When a person understands that they are asking for protection from the "punishment of the grave" or seeking "well-being in this world and the hereafter," the emotional weight of the prayer increases. In Islamic practice, the conclusion of the five daily obligatory prayers ( Solat Fardu ) is not the end of the spiritual encounter, but rather a transition into a period of intimate remembrance known as Wirid or Dhikr . This specific 18:30-minute sequence typically follows the Prophetic tradition, beginning with seeking forgiveness ( Istighfar ), acknowledging the oneness of God ( Tahmid and Tasbih ), and culminating in a comprehensive Doa (supplication). The set duration helps practitioners integrate a full, unhurried session of dhikr into their schedules, preventing the common habit of rushing away immediately after the final Salam .

The "Free Music Download" aspect highlights a communal value in Islamic digital spaces: the free sharing of beneficial knowledge ( Ilmu yang bermanfaat ). By making these resources accessible without a paywall, digital platforms allow users from all economic backgrounds to access high-quality spiritual recordings. These Mp3s are often used not just on personal phones, but are played in households, small prayer rooms ( surau ), and during commutes, turning mundane spaces into environments of remembrance.
